Jesus and taxes

So about 2000 years ago a Hebrew rabbi was leading a peaceful rebellion against the establishment of his day. Cornered by both the religious and governmental aristocracy, he was asked in front of his followers, “Is it lawful to pay taxes to Caesar, or not?”

Good question. He answered, “Render therefore to Caesar the things that are Caesar’s, and to God the things that are God’s”. Seems pretty cut and dry, right? We should pay our taxes. So then why did the religious folk respond like this… “When they had heard these words, they marveled, and left Him and went their way”.
